软件编程一级是什么水平

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    软件编程一级可以理解为编程技能的入门水平。在软件编程领域,一级通常是指对基本编程概念和技术有一定了解和掌握的程度。下面将从知识、技能和能力三个方面来介绍软件编程一级的水平。

    一、知识水平:
    在软件编程一级水平上,学习者应该具备以下基本知识:

    1. 理解计算机的基本原理和工作方式,包括计算机硬件、操作系统和网络等基础知识;
    2. 掌握基本的编程语言知识,如C、C++、Python等,了解它们的语法和基本用法;
    3. 理解常见的数据结构和算法,如数组、链表、栈、队列、排序算法等;
    4. 了解软件开发的基本过程和方法,如需求分析、设计、编码、测试和维护等;
    5. 熟悉常见的开发工具和环境,如集成开发环境(IDE)、版本控制工具(Git)等。

    二、技能水平:
    软件编程一级的学习者应该具备以下基本技能:

    1. 能够使用基本的编程语言完成简单的程序编写,如实现一些基本的算法和数据结构;
    2. 能够理解和分析简单的编程问题,并能够设计合适的解决方案;
    3. 具备基本的调试和排错能力,能够找出程序中的错误并进行修复;
    4. 能够阅读和理解他人的代码,能够进行简单的代码修改和优化;
    5. 具备基本的文档编写和团队协作能力,能够撰写简单的开发文档和与他人进行有效的沟通。

    三、能力水平:
    软件编程一级的学习者应该具备以下基本能力:

    1. 能够独立完成简单的编程任务,如编写一个简单的计算器、实现一个简单的游戏等;
    2. 能够根据需求进行简单的软件设计和开发,包括界面设计、功能实现等;
    3. 具备解决简单编程问题的能力,能够运用已有的知识和技能解决实际问题;
    4. 具备学习和研究新技术的能力,能够不断提升自己的编程水平;
    5. 具备良好的问题分析和解决能力,能够快速定位和解决程序中的错误和bug。

    总之,软件编程一级水平是指对基本的编程知识、技能和能力有一定了解和掌握的程度,是学习者在软件编程领域的入门水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    软件编程一级是指在软件开发领域中具备基本的编程能力和技术知识的水平。以下是软件编程一级的几个主要特点:

    1. 掌握基本的编程语言:软件编程一级的人应该熟悉至少一种主流的编程语言,如C、C++、Java、Python等,并能够使用这些语言进行基本的编程操作。

    2. 理解基本的编程概念:软件编程一级的人应该了解常见的编程概念,如变量、数据类型、运算符、条件语句、循环语句等,并能够根据需求使用这些概念进行编程。

    3. 熟悉常见的开发工具和环境:软件编程一级的人应该熟悉常见的开发工具和环境,如集成开发环境(IDE)、代码编辑器、调试工具等,并能够使用这些工具进行代码编写、调试和测试。

    4. 能够解决简单的编程问题:软件编程一级的人应该能够解决一些简单的编程问题,如求解数学问题、实现简单的算法、处理基本的数据结构等。

    5. 具备良好的编程习惯和文档能力:软件编程一级的人应该具备良好的编程习惯,包括规范的命名、适当的注释、可读性强的代码等,并能够编写清晰、准确的文档来记录代码的功能和使用方法。

    需要注意的是,软件编程一级只是软件开发领域中的一个起点,随着技术的不断进步和学习的深入,人们可以逐渐提升自己的编程水平,达到更高级别的技术要求。因此,软件编程一级只是一个初级的水平标准,不代表一个人在软件开发领域中的全部能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    软件编程一级是指在软件编程领域具备基础知识和技能的水平。具体来说,软件编程一级的水平包括以下几个方面:

    1. 编程基础知识:掌握编程语言的基本语法和常用数据类型,了解程序的运行原理和基本概念,如变量、函数、条件语句、循环结构等。

    2. 程序设计能力:能够分析问题并设计合理的程序解决方案,具备基本的算法思维和逻辑思维能力,能够使用编程语言实现简单的算法和逻辑。

    3. 编码能力:熟悉使用开发工具和集成开发环境(IDE),能够编写简单的程序代码,包括变量定义、函数定义、语句调用等。

    4. 调试和排错能力:能够使用调试工具和技巧,找出程序中的错误和问题,并进行修复和改进。

    5. 代码管理和版本控制:了解代码管理的基本原则和流程,能够使用版本控制工具进行代码的管理和协同开发。

    6. 文档撰写能力:能够编写清晰、规范的代码注释和文档,能够描述程序的功能、使用方法和注意事项。

    7. 团队协作能力:具备良好的沟通能力和合作意识,能够与他人合作完成项目开发任务。

    要达到软件编程一级的水平,可以通过以下方法和操作流程进行学习和提升:

    1. 学习编程语言基础知识:选择一种常用的编程语言,如Python、Java等,学习其基本语法和常用数据类型,掌握变量定义、运算符、条件语句、循环结构等基本概念。

    2. 理解程序设计思想:学习基本的算法和逻辑思维,理解程序的设计和实现过程,掌握常见的程序设计方法和技巧。

    3. 练习编程实践:通过编写简单的程序练习,如计算器、学生成绩管理系统等,加深对编程语言和程序设计的理解,提升编码能力。

    4. 学习调试技巧:掌握使用调试工具和技巧,如断点调试、日志输出等,能够快速定位和修复程序中的错误和问题。

    5. 学习代码管理和版本控制:了解代码管理的基本原则和流程,学习使用版本控制工具,如Git,进行代码的管理和协同开发。

    6. 注重文档撰写和代码规范:养成良好的代码注释和文档编写习惯,描述程序的功能、使用方法和注意事项,遵循编码规范,提高代码的可读性和维护性。

    7. 参与项目实践:积极参与项目开发,与他人合作完成任务,锻炼团队协作能力和项目管理能力。

    通过以上方法和操作流程的学习和实践,可以逐步提高软件编程的水平,达到软件编程一级的水平。但需要注意的是,软件编程的水平是一个渐进的过程,需要持续学习和实践,不断提升自己的技能和能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部